Definition

A female first name, usually used as a short form of Pamela. It refers to a person, not a general object or action.

Usage & Nuances

Used as a person's name, so it is normally capitalized as 'Pam'. In real use, it often appears in introductions, direct address, possessive forms like 'Pam's car', and references to specific people.
